A spot trade refers to the buying or selling of a foreign currency, financial instrument, or commodity for immediate delivery on a specified date. This transaction typically involves the actual receipt of the currency, commodity, or instrument. The price variation between a spot contract and a future or forward contract is influenced by factors such as interest rates and the duration until maturity. In the context of foreign exchange, the exchange rate applied is termed the spot exchange rate.

A stockbroker is a licensed professional or institution that buys and sells financial securities on behalf of their clients. Stockbrokers act as an intermediary between investors and the stock exchange, in this case, NSE and BSE. They help facilitate transactions that help clients build or adjust their portfolios.

Due to the growth of online brokers, the cost of executing trades has significantly decreased. Many brokers offer a commission rebate to their customers if they perform a certain amount of trades/dollar value per month. This is specifically important for a short-term trader as it is necessary to keep the execution costs as low as possible.
